Let’s be honest, talking about politics in student ministry sounds like a fast track to awkward silence, hurt feelings, or a room divided. But what if there was a way to guide students through political conversations with wisdom, grace, and a biblical foundation without it turning into a debate or disaster?

Navigating Politics is a full one-off teaching resource designed to help students think critically and biblically about the role politics plays in their lives, without telling them what to think or who to vote for. Instead, this message asks a more important question: How should followers of Jesus approach politics while keeping Christ at the center?

Whether your students are deeply invested in political issues or want nothing to do with them, this resource creates a safe space to talk about what Scripture says and why our ultimate hope can’t rest in political systems, but must rest in the Kingdom of God.
